Output 7a301d161d981ae29465342d0c0a32d61323dd84475d17a661df614227ef3bd5:4

value
668621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e02c5c545adad46b58337852e20f14165081b27 OP_EQUAL
address
34RhWwNRSeCCPDknqshm4Kk89T28T4TqHY
transaction
7a301d161d981ae29465342d0c0a32d61323dd84475d17a661df614227ef3bd5
spent
true